🔧 Как организовать автоматическую проверку доступности сервиса с помощью systemd
Привет, друзья! 🚀
Сегодня расскажу, как сделать так, чтобы ваш сервис всегда был онлайн, а при сбое — автоматически перезапускался. Не нужно писать сложных скриптов — весь секрет в правильной настройке systemd!
Для этого достаточно создать юнит, который будет контролировать ваш сервис. В нем можно прописать параметры типа Restart=always или OnFailure= — и systemd позаботится о восстановлении.
Преимущества такого подхода:
- Беспрерывная работа сервиса
- Минимум внимания — systemd сам всё решит
- Легкая настройка и мониторинг
Пример: создайте файл /etc/systemd/system/myservice.service с настройками, где указаны команда запуска и параметры перезапуска — и перезагрузите демон командой systemctl daemon-reload.
Готовые решения помогают не только автоматизировать контроль, но и снизить человеческий фактор, сохраняя ваше время и нервы.
А как вы обычно решаете вопросы отказов сервисов? Есть ли свои хитрости?
👀 Больше полезных статей ты найдешь в нашем телеграм-канале https://t.me/LinuxSkill, а вакансии для системных администраторов — в боте https://t.me/gradeliftbot.
📩 Завтра: как настроить Fail2Ban за 5 минут! Включи 🔔 чтобы не пропустить!